In this review of the Women's Thermoball Traction Mule V, the bottom line is simple: these are warm, easy slip-on winter shoes best suited for casual outdoor use, base camp downtime, and everyday cold-weather errands. The shoe stands out for its use of ThermoBall Eco insulation and a cushioned, fleece-lined collar that deliver noticeable warmth without bulk. Reviewers consistently praise the comfort and overall quality, though fit and slip-on ease vary between wearers; expect a snug, insulated mule that prioritizes warmth and convenience over a loose, roomy fit.
Key Features
- ThermoBall Eco insulation: Holds heat effectively even in damp conditions so toes stay warm on cold mornings or at camp.
- Oso fleece-lined collar: Adds a soft, cushioned opening that increases comfort and reduces friction when slipping the shoe on or off.
- Water-resistant ripstop upper: Made from 100% recycled polyester with a non-PFC DWR finish to repel light moisture and snow during brief outdoor use.
- Collapsible heel and stretchy panels: Enable quick slip-in convenience while maintaining a secure fit when the heel is up.
- Grippy rubber outsole: Provides steady traction on slick decks and icy walkways, with up to 20% recycled rubber for added environmental benefit.
- Durable construction: Quality materials and solid assembly give these mules a longer useful life for casual winter wear.
Who It's For
The Thermoball Traction Mule V is designed for women who need a warm, low-effort shoe for short outdoor trips, apres ski lounging, or running quick errands in cold weather. It's ideal for someone who values insulation and slip-on convenience over a highly structured hiking shoe.
Those who need a precise athletic fit, extended hiking support, or fully waterproof footwear for prolonged wet conditions should look elsewhere. Similarly, if you prefer roomy footwear to wear with thick socks, consider sizing advice carefully since user reports vary on snugness.

Specifications
| Product type | Insulated slip-on mule |
| Insulation | ThermoBall Eco, 100% recycled polyester |
| Upper | Ripstop, 100% recycled polyester with non-PFC DWR |
| Collar lining | Oso fleece |
| Outsole | Rubber with up to 20% recycled rubber for traction |
| Closure | Collapsible heel with stretchy side panels (slip-on) |

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these fully waterproof?
They are water-resistant with a non-PFC DWR but not fully waterproof, so avoid prolonged exposure to deep wet conditions.
Do they run true to size?
Fit varies: some find them true to size and comfortable without socks, while others report a snug fit; consider trying your normal size or sizing up if you wear thick socks.
Can you use them for hiking?
They are best for light outdoor use, base camp, and short walks; they are not intended as a structured hiking shoe for long trails.
